What Does Wyll Mean in Text & Chat?
In texting and online chats, “wyll” usually stands for “what you look like?” It is a short internet slang phrase people use when they want to know someone’s appearance.
The term is common in:
- Text messages
- Snapchat chats
- TikTok comments
- Instagram DMs
- Online gaming chats
People often use “wyll” when talking to someone new online. Instead of typing the full question, they shorten it to save time.
Simple Chat Examples
- “Hey, wyll?”
- “We’ve been talking all day 😂 wyll?”
- “You seem cool. Wyll?”
Most of the time, the person is asking for:
- A selfie
- A profile picture
- A physical description
The tone can be friendly, playful, or flirty depending on the conversation. However, not everyone feels comfortable sharing photos online, so it is okay to reply politely if you do not want to.

Full Form, Stands For & Short Meaning of Wyll
The full meaning of “wyll” is:
WYLL = “What You Look Like?”
It is not an official acronym like those used in business or education. Instead, it is internet slang made from the first letters and sounds of the sentence.
Short Meaning
- Asking about someone’s appearance
- Requesting a picture
- Curious about how someone looks

Origin, History & First Known Use of Wyll
The exact first use of “wyll” is hard to track because internet slang spreads quickly across apps and private chats. However, the phrase became widely noticed during the early 2020s.
Social media platforms helped the slang grow fast. TikTok, Snapchat, and Instagram played a major role in making “wyll” popular among teens and young adults.
Why It Became Popular
People online prefer:
- Faster typing
- Short messages
- Casual communication
Instead of typing:
“What do you look like?”
Users shortened it to:
“wyll”
This style matches other modern internet slang trends. Many abbreviations today remove extra words and punctuation to make chats quicker.

Common Confusions, Mistakes & Wrong Interpretations
Many internet users misunderstand “wyll” the first time they see it. Since slang changes quickly, confusion is normal.
Common Mistakes
Thinking It Is a Typo
Some people believe “wyll” is just a misspelling of:
- “Will”
- “Well”
But in slang conversations, it usually has a completely different meaning.
Assuming It Is Offensive
“Wyll” itself is not rude. However, repeated requests for photos may make someone uncomfortable.
Tone matters.
Confusing It With Other Slang
Users sometimes mix it up with:
- WDYLL
- WYD
- WYM
Each abbreviation means something different.
Quick Comparison
- WYD = What You Doing?
- WYM = What You Mean?
- WYLL = What You Look Like?
Understanding small differences helps avoid awkward replies in chats.

How to Reply When Someone Says Wyll
There is no single correct way to answer “wyll.” Your reply depends on your comfort level and the situation.
If You Want to Share
- “Here’s a selfie 😊”
- “Check my Insta.”
- “I’ll send a pic lol”
If You Do Not Want To
- “I’m shy online 😅”
- “Maybe later.”
- “I don’t share pics much.”
Funny Replies
- “Nice try FBI 😂”
- “Imagine a superhero but tired.”
- “Use your imagination 👀”
Always remember:
You never have to share personal photos online if you do not feel safe or comfortable.
Good online communication includes respecting boundaries.
